    well, finally got it sorted. went through the left hand side lights and pinned it down to the light in the arb bull bar. disconnected light and put standard fuses in and tested all other indicators and all were fine. checked the culprit light for broken wires or dodgy connector which was all good. bulb tested good as well. ended up putting it all back together and bingo. the only thing I can put it down to may-be bulb was not in right and was shorting out. yendor was right on the money with trouble shooting and thanks to others for your input.
